In the world of online media and content distribution, "patched" is a term that has several meanings. For video games, "patched" can refer to an English translation patch that changes the game's language, making it playable in a different region. In the context of video files, "patched" could mean that the file has been altered, either to bypass geographic or platform restrictions, or to hide watermarks to circumvent copyright detection. For paid or exclusive video content, "patched" can also be slang for a cracked version of a file that has been modified to remove payment requirements or digital rights management (DRM).
